A bar magnet of length \(l\) and magnetic dipole moment \(M\) is bent in the form of an arc as shown in the figure. The new magnetic dipole moment will be:

1. \(\dfrac{3M}{\pi}\) 2. \(\dfrac{2M}{l\pi}\)
3. \(\dfrac{M}{ 2}\) 4. \(M\)

A bar magnet of the magnetic moment \(M\) is placed at right angles to a magnetic induction \(B.\) If a force \(F\) is experienced by each pole of the magnet, the length of the magnet will be:
1. \(\frac{MB}{F}\) 2. \(\frac{BF}{M}\)
3. \(\frac{MF}{B}\) 4. \(\frac{F}{MB}\)

A vibration magnetometer placed in a magnetic meridian has a small bar magnet. The magnet executes oscillations with a time period of 2 s in the earth's horizontal magnetic field of 24 μT. When a horizontal field of 18 μT is produced opposite to the earth's field by placing a current-carrying wire, the new time period of the magnet will be:

1. 1 s

2. 2 s

3. 3 s

4. 4 s

A bar magnet having a magnetic moment of \(2\times10^4\) JT-1 is free to rotate in a horizontal plane. A horizontal magnetic field \(B=6\times10^{-4}\) T exists in the space. The work done in taking the magnet slowly from a direction parallel to the field to a direction \(60^\circ\) from the field is:
1. \(0.6\) J
2. \(12\) J
3. \(6\) J
4. \(2\) J
